Introduction

The Fountain School of Performing Arts welcomes students interested in the study of musicology at the graduate level, leading to the MA degree. Students in the MA in Musicology program will have the opportunity to investigate music's role and meaning in various social and historical contexts, through text-based analysis informed by cultural studies. Our faculty members pursue research in genres ranging from medieval chant to contemporary experimental composition, canonic orchestral repertoire, film music, and diverse styles understood to be popular music. We foster a vibrant intellectual climate that encourages innovative approaches and non-traditional thinking about music as a social text, and the small size of our program guarantees a great deal of specialized attention and the possibility of tailoring courses of study to suit individual interests. The MA in Musicology is suitable preparation for doctoral studies in musicology and some other humanities disciplines, as well as work in the fields of journalism, music education, editing, and arts administration.
